Occupier Project Process

Sales

Strategy

Implementation

Follow-up

Project Opportunity

Opportunity comes in

Project Opportunity

GNG Discussion

Send client contact information and all existing project information with your GNG request.

Marketing will open the project number.

GNG Discussion

Schedule GNG with:

  • Principal in charge of Project Delivery
  • Director leading Occupier Services
  • Account Leader
  • Director of Marketing
  • Contact who brought in the opportunity
  • PM of existing account

GNG Criteria

GNG

Criteria

Do we want it?

Can we get it?

For specific criteria, refer to the Knowledgebase.

No Go

If it is a No Go, consult with Marketing for the best strategy to decline the project.

Marketing will close the opportunity in Vision.

No Go

Project Team

Roles and Responsibilities

During the GNG, decide on who the PM and team should be.

Managing Director (MD)

Communicate assignment to PM, download project information from GNG call and pass on the project number.

Project Manager (PM)

Communicate existing project number to PC and update project team members

Project Team

Preliminary Client Meeting

Preliminary Client Meeting

Required: DOS/ PM / AL

Identify scope

Identify budget for the project

Identify schedule

Identify client point of contact

Understand business goals and drivers 

Identify broker and terms of the deal

Scope Definition, Schedule and Staffing Plan

Required: (DOS / PM / AL)

PM and DOS will present to the client the scope and schedule for approval

PM will decide on SAA staffing plan including direct project team and resource groups

PM / AL will decide on outside consultants

AL should provide relevant staffing, resources and consultant history

Scope Definition, Schedule and Staffing Plan

Communication Plan

Communication Plan

Required: (DOS / PM / AL)

Research existing client communication preferences in Vision.

Identify any modification and document in Vision.

This includes:

  • Client's communication preferences
  • SAA's communication leader
  • Identify DOS' responsibility
  • Identify PM's responsibility
  • Identify AL responsibility

Record project communication in the activities tab of the project.

Set up Checkpoint Meetings

Set up Checkpoint Meetings

Required: (DOS / PM)

Confirm:

  • The project is on schedule
  • The project is within the estimated budget (internal and construction)
  • Any scope changes and how to communicate with the client
  • Any potential issues that may come up and an action plan
  • Documenting the weekly check point meetings using formatted template from Knowledge Base and file in project folder.

Initial Proposed Phase

Initial Proposed Phase

Required: (DOS / PM / AL)

DOS/AL provides scope review

AL provides relevant fee history

PM and MD owns fees

Customize QA/QC plan with relevant account process, standard and milestones

Visioning: Offer ideas, concepts and imagination to help them see what they don't know yet. Include in scope of work.

Programming Phase

(if not provided by a client)

Programming Phase

Required: (DOS / PM / Designer)

DOS, PM and Designer to meet with client and possibly their department managers

Using SAA Programing template and questionnaire, gather the information necessary to complete the Programming Phase

PM will issue the Program spreadsheet to the client for approval

QC checkpoint

Test Fit Phase

(once the program is approved by the client)

Test Fit Phase

Required: (PM / Designer)

Using the Programming information, PM will work with Designer and lead the process for the completion of the Test Fit

PM will issue to the client for approval

PM to follow-up to make sure the client received and reviewed

QC checkpoint: PM to make sure there is an internal review to see if there are any issues with the plan and communicate them to the client.

City Due Diligence

City Due Diligence

Required: (PM / JC )

Once the proposal is approved, PM and JC will schedule a meeting with the city for preliminary review of the plan to make sure there are no issues with any code compliance, as well as turnaround time frame for the Plan Check review

PM will communicate to the client any out of the scope items they find out from the city, as well as the approximate time frame

QC checkpoint

Schematic Design Phase

Tip: Control is the key to this phase.

Do not show more or less than is required.

We need to know the advantages and the disadvantages of what we are presenting and clearly communicate now.

Make sure all items are within the schedule and budget. Cannot go over without communicating and adjusting fees.

Schematic Design Phase

Required: (DOS / PM / Designer / Resource Groups)

PM will put together preliminary schedule for the projects and communicate with client

PM will put together a preliminary construction budget with whatever information is available to help the client's expectations and be a communication tool for the Resource Groups. (If needed, ask for assistance for putting together a budget)

DOS, PM and Designer will schedule a meeting with the client to understand the complexity and quality of materials and design for the project

PM will coordinate with Design Group and lead the process for the completion of Schematic Design

PM will review the Schematic Design with DOS and PM will issue for client's approval

QC checkpoint

Design Development Phase

Remember

Make sure all designs are within the schedule and budget as well as all project goals.

Share project renderings with Marketing!

Design Development Phase

Required: (DOS / PM / AL/ Designer / Resource Groups)

Once the SD is approved: Based on the meeting with the client (for SD and DD), PM will schedule a meeting to coordinate the DD efforts

This will include:

  • Understanding the client's expectations
  • Schedule for preliminary review (internally)
  • Discuss what Consultants and Resource Groups needed for the project AND document
  • Discuss all possible challenges to expect on the project, assign responsibilities, AND document in details
  • Schedule final delivery of the DD package
  • Schedule DD review/presentation meeting with the client
  • Confirm how the information is sent and received including any changes
  • PM and Design team will meet with the client to review and approve (or make any changes) DD package
  • QC checkpoint

Final Fee Proposal

(if not included in initial proposal)

Final Fee Proposal

Required: (DOS / PM )

PM will estimate fee to include Preliminary City Due Diligence, additional field verification needed, construction documents, plan check process, construction phase services and any outside consultants needed

PM and JC will call the city to understand all their requirements, process and turnaround time

PM will review proposal with DOS and issue to the client for approval

PM will call the client to make sure they received the proposal and review to make sure the client understands what is included

Construction Document Phase

As the deadline approaches:

  • PM will have a final checkpoint meeting with the team and make sure the team is on schedule
  • PM will designate a QC person and make sure the QC process is done in a timely manner before issuing the drawings
  • PM/JC will follow-up with all of the Consultants to make sure they will have their drawings completed by the set timeline
  • PM will issue the CD's and meet with the client to review and approve

Construction Document Phase

Required: (AL / PM / JC / D of A /Resource Groups / outside consultants)

Before starting the CD's, PM and JC must outline in writing the sequence of tasks within the CD's:

  • PM and JC will make a list of all the items that are needed from the client to complete the CD's with dates needed by
  • PM and JC will make a list of all the questions the team might have for the client
  • PM will have a kick-off meeting with JC, Designer and Resource Group to discuss responsibilities, tasks and schedule
  • PM will schedule periodic meetings with the team as a checkpoint to make sure everyone is on schedule and can meet the targeted dates
  • PM and DOS will schedule review meeting (s) with the client
  • PM and DOS will have periodic progress meetings within CD phase
  • PM/DOS will have periodic call with the client to check-in and give them updates on the progress throughout the project

Plan Check Process Phase

Remember

Communicate with client, client PM, contractor etc. upfront of any possible delays and set expectations immediately.

Plan Check Process Phase

Required: (PM / JC / Expeditor)

JC/Expeditor will meet with the City Plan Checker or submit the drawings

PM will communicate with the client

PM/ JC to follow-up with the Plan Checker periodically to make sure we are on schedule

If/when we receive PC corrections: PM/ JC will review all corrections, put together timeframe and communicate with client

Construction Phase Services

Note

DOS will check in with client periodically and communicate any changes or issues

Construction Phase Services

Required: (DOS / PM / JC / AL/ Resource Groups)

PM will make sure all RFI's and Submittals are reviewed and answered in a timely manner. This includes consulting with DG and other consultants as needed.

PM/JC will document all meeting notes (even if a Construction Manager or GC is issuing official meeting minutes)

PM will issue a recap after a meeting that includes all action items, responsible parties and the due dates

PM will review the internal financial report for the project weekly (including all Resource Groups) to make sure we are staying within budget. This includes all meetings as well as other Resource Groups involved with the project. PM will communicate with all Resource Groups about their budget as well as how much they have spent, what is the percentage of completion and how much is left in their budget.

QC checkpoint

Client Follow-up

Project Close Out

Required: DOS/PM

Set follow up dates with the client to continue relationship touchpoints.

Leverage Marketing for event, gift and email ideas for clients.

Continue to update Activities section in Vision with correspondence
